Maquinas de turing

11
Máquinas de Turing Mitra Mejia 13-1060 Daniel Moreno 13-1076

Transcript of Maquinas de turing

Page 1: Maquinas de turing

Máquinas de TuringMitra Mejia 13-1060Daniel Moreno 13-1076

Page 2: Maquinas de turing

Máquina de Turing

Alan Turing introdujo el concepto de máquina de Turing, publicado por la Sociedad Matemática de Londres en 1936. Turing ideó un modelo formal de computador, la máquina de Turing.

Page 3: Maquinas de turing

¿Qué es una máquina de Turing?

Una máquina de Turing es un modelo computacional que realiza una lectura / escritura de manera automática sobre una entrada llamada cinta, generando una salida en la esta misma.

Page 4: Maquinas de turing

Representación

Page 5: Maquinas de turing

¿Cómo funcionan?

Page 7: Maquinas de turing

Máquina de Turing Determinista

En el caso de que para cada par (estado, símbolo) posible exista a lo sumo una posibilidad de ejecución, se dirá que es una máquina de Turing determinista.

Page 8: Maquinas de turing

Máquina de Turing No Determinista

En el caso de que exista al menos un par (estado, símbolo) con más de una posible combinación de actuaciones se dirá que se trata de una máquina de Turing no determinista.

Page 9: Maquinas de turing

Máquina de Turing Multicinta

Es una Máquina de Turing... con 2 o más cintas y cabezales

Page 10: Maquinas de turing

Ejemplo

0ab 1aa, IID

A P

Page 11: Maquinas de turing

Referenciashttp://www.google.com/doodles/alan-turings-100th-birthday

https://es.wikipedia.org/wiki/Alan_Turing

http://maquinaturing.blogspot.com/p/funcionamiento-de-la-maquina-turing.html

https://www.youtube.com/watch?v=Ls-pBGz57uc

http://www.sinewton.org/numeros/numeros/43-44/Articulo33.pdf

https://www.youtube.com/watch?v=dNRDvLACg5Q